Official use of P.A.D.S. requires a licensed interface (such as the Axone 4 or the newer Biturbo diagnostic tablet) and a valid software subscription. The cost of entry for these tools can run into thousands of dollars, putting them out of reach for independent smaller shops and home mechanics.

– No legitimate “fixed” version exists. Consider alternative generic OBD2 software (e.g., Guzzidiag for Moto Guzzi or IAWDiag for Piaggio/Vespa engines) for basic diagnostics, though they lack full dealer-level functions.
